BMW Group Korea announced on the 6th that it has introduced an integrated vehicle management solution across all service centers operated by its seven authorized dealer groups nationwide, as part of its initiative to expand digital after-sales services.
The newly implemented Intelligent Workshop System (IWS) is a digital vehicle management platform integrated with the company’s unified customer management system, MyDMS.
BMW Group Korea oversaw the system’s overall planning, operation, and architecture, while software development was carried out by EPIKAR, an automotive digital transformation company.
The IWS system enables real-time monitoring and recording of the entire service workflow—from vehicle check-in and service reception to consultation, maintenance scheduling, repair progress, completion, and final vehicle delivery.
By digitizing all service touchpoints, the platform allows service advisors and technicians to quickly verify vehicle status and respond more efficiently throughout the repair process.
BMW Group Korea plans to deploy the IWS system across all BMW and MINI authorized service centers nationwide, with the goal of improving operational efficiency and significantly reducing customer waiting times.
